Sanbaoshu is named after three special ancient trees, two cryptomeria trees and one ginkgo tree. Here, the sun is covered with thick shade and the green waves are rolling to the sky. Three towering ancient trees stand in the sky. Two are cryptomeria trees, each about 40 meters high. One is a ginkgo tree, about 30 meters high. The main trunk is like a pagoda that can’t be hugged by several people. It is said that the Three Treasure Tree is a thousand-year-old Ke Ke. The stone tablet under the tree is engraved with the six characters “Notes of Monk Tan Shen of Jin Dynasty”. The treasure tree has been under special protection.

How to visit Sanbaoshu within the scenic area
Sanbaoshu is located in the deep valley of Huanglongtan under Lulin Artificial Lake. You can reach it by walking up the forest stone steps for about 300 meters.
